113 STAT. 1212 PUBLIC LAW 106-79 —OCT. 25, 1999 Public Law 106-79 106th Congress An Act Oct. 25, 1999 Making appropriations for the Department of Defense for the fiscal year ending [H.R. 2561] September 30, 2000, and for other purposes.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of Department of the United States of America in Congress assembled, That the Defense following sums are appropriated, out of any money in the Treasury Act^'2^^*^°'^^ ^®* otherwise appropriated, for the fiscal year ending September 30, 2000, for military fimctions administered by the Depeirtment of Defense, and for other purposes, namely: TITLE I MILITARY PERSONNEL MILITARY PERSONNEL, ARMY For pay, allowances, individual clothing, subsistence, interest on deposits, gratuities, permanent change of station travel (including all expenses thereof for organizational movements), and expenses of temporary duty travel between permanent duty stations, for members of the Army on active duty (except members of reserve components provided for elsewhere), cadets, and aviation cadets; and for payments pursuant to section 156 of Public Law 97-377, as amended (42 U.S.C. 402 note), to section 229(b) of the Social Security Act (42 U.S.C. 429(b)), and to the Department of Defense Military Retirement Fund, $22,006,361,000. MILITARY PERSONNEL, NAVY For pay, allowances, individual clothing, subsistence, interest on deposits, gratuities, permanent change of station travel (including all expenses thereof for organizationed movements), and expenses of temporary duty travel between permanent duty stations, for members of the Navy on active duty (except members of the Reserve provided for elsewhere), midshipmen, and aviation cadets; and for payments pursuant to section 156 of Public Law 97-377, as amended (42 U.S.C. 402 note), to section 229(b) of the Social Security Act (42 U.S.C. 429(b)), and to the Department of Defense Military Retirement Fund, $17,258,823,000.
